The reports swirling around the Giants related to quarterbacks in the draft clearly point to a franchise that is ready to move on from Jones, who played in six games last season and needed surgery on a torn ACL on Thanksgiving. In those games, Jones threw for 909 yards with two touchdowns and six interceptions, while getting sacked 30 times. Jones last offseason signed a four-year, $160 million deal that is really a two-year, $82 million deal.
